This error comes up if someone has recently upgraded to a new version of EndNote
Endnote Error Serialized Data
and Word is still calling up the older version. The "Upgrade" version of EndNote is actually a full, independent installation of endnote error 1717 the program. It does not actually update an existing version but installs separately. So these users probably still have the old version installed (or at least the old CWYW files or registry associations). If you have http://lists.adeptscience.co.uk/endnote/endnote_Jul_2004/thid_c7a205e5d954218a995cddb0987d5d4f.html more than one version of EndNote installed on your computer, the "Go to EndNote" command in Word appears to go to whichever one was last used with Word. The best way to clear this up is to close all programs, back up your EndNote libraries and any customized content files, then uninstall all versions of EndNote on the machine via the Add/Remove Programs applet on the Control Panel.
